Prime Minister Boris Johnson has been moved to intensive care after his condition worsened, Downing Street has said.

He was admitted to hospital last night due to ‘persistent’ COVID-19 symptoms but was moved to intensive care at 7pm.

Before he was admitted, it’s understood he asked the Foreign Secretary Dominic Raab to deputise for him as necessary.
